mirror of
https://github.com/espressif/binutils-gdb.git
synced 2025-10-11 01:48:46 +08:00
* config/tc-ppc.c (ppc_pe_comm): Set bfd_com_section segment.
* config/tc-alpha.c (s_alpha_comm): Likewise. Also, remove redundant check. * read.c (s_lsym): Remove non-BFD assembler sym handling.
This commit is contained in:
@ -3331,10 +3331,10 @@ s_alpha_comm (int ignore ATTRIBUTE_UNUSED)
|
||||
subseg_set (new_seg, 0);
|
||||
p = frag_more (temp);
|
||||
new_seg->flags |= SEC_IS_COMMON;
|
||||
if (! S_IS_DEFINED (symbolP))
|
||||
S_SET_SEGMENT (symbolP, new_seg);
|
||||
S_SET_SEGMENT (symbolP, new_seg);
|
||||
#else
|
||||
S_SET_VALUE (symbolP, (valueT) temp);
|
||||
S_SET_SEGMENT (symbolP, bfd_com_section_ptr);
|
||||
#endif
|
||||
S_SET_EXTERNAL (symbolP);
|
||||
}
|
||||
|
@ -4416,6 +4416,7 @@ ppc_pe_comm (lcomm)
|
||||
{
|
||||
S_SET_VALUE (symbolP, (valueT) temp);
|
||||
S_SET_EXTERNAL (symbolP);
|
||||
S_SET_SEGMENT (symbolP, bfd_com_section_ptr);
|
||||
}
|
||||
|
||||
demand_empty_rest_of_line ();
|
||||
|
Reference in New Issue
Block a user